Ema Datshi Eggs is a quick adaptation of Bhutan’s beloved chilli-and-cheese preparation. Traditional ema datshi is considered Bhutan’s national dish and is usually made with chillies simmered in a rich cheese sauce. This version adds eggs, making the dish heartier while keeping the creamy and mildly spicy character that has made the original famous across the Himalayan region. For anyone looking for an easy ema datshi recipe, this variation offers a practical way to enjoy similar flavours at home. The combination of garlic, chillies, cheese, and softly cooked eggs creates a satisfying meal that works well for breakfast, brunch, or even a light lunch. The sauce comes together quickly, making it suitable for busy weekdays. Inspired by the Bhutanese cuisine, this ema datshi recipe highlights how a few simple ingredients can create a comforting dish with plenty of flavour. The creaminess of the cheese balances the heat from the chillies, while the eggs add protein and richness. Serve it fresh with steamed rice, toasted bread, or warm flatbreads for a complete meal.

Ingredients

UNITSIngredients
1 teaspoonOil
4Eggs
1 tablespoonButter
1 teaspoonGarlic, finely chopped
½ teaspoonGreen chilli, chopped
½ cupHot water
1 tablespoonCream cheese
¼ cupMozzarella cheese (optional)
to tasteSalt
½ teaspoon cornCornflour slurry cornflour mixed with 1 teaspoon water

Directions

Description - Step 1

Step 1: Cook The Eggs

Heat a small amount of oil in a frying pan over medium heat. Carefully crack the eggs into the pan and cook them sunny-side up until the whites are set while the yolks remain slightly soft. Transfer the eggs to a plate and keep them aside while preparing the sauce.
